Electric Fireplace

Electric fireplaces are an excellent way to add warmth and coziness to any room. These fireplaces have a variety of advantages over traditional wood-burning fireplaces, including no need for gas lines or chimneys and no fire risk. Installation is also simple and requires only a flat wall and power outlet. They can be even installed in rooms where there is no ventilation as they do not produce sparks or smoke.

Electric fireplaces are available in various styles, depending on the model you select and your needs. There are standalone models that resemble traditional fireplaces; wall mounts and recessed models that can be attached to the wall or incorporated into the wall; and inserts that can be installed in older fireplaces to alter the fuel source.

All of these kinds of electric fireplaces are available in a variety of styles and colors to fit your decor. Some have flames that are more realistic than others, but they all provide a huge deal of warmth without any smoke or ash. The LED lights reflect the heat produced by the heating coils inside the unit. These lights can be set to turn on and off independently of the flames. Certain models can be controlled with the remote, while other models can be linked to your smart devices to allow you to change them at any time in the world.

Electric fireplaces can even be mounted in 2x4 walls or recessed into the wall, which saves space. electric fireplace with wood mantel , which are less than 4 inches wide and feature multicolor flames that create an impressive and realistic display. Some of these models have three sides, which means you can enjoy the flames from any direction.

Electric fireplaces are also safe and are a huge attraction for those who have pets or children. Electric fireplaces do not emit sparks or smoke, nor do they emit harmful gases. They are therefore more secure than an open-fire that burns wood. A lot of these fireplaces have automated shut-off mechanisms as well as cool-touch exteriors to make them more kid-friendly. They can also be turned on or off by pressing the remote's button which makes them extremely convenient for busy households.

Corbels

A corbel is an architectural bracket that adds beauty to the design of your home. Corbels of wood, which were originally used to support structures, are now carved with unique designs and can be used to decorate. These decorative features are great on cabinets and walls as well as to display artworks that are framed. They are available in a variety of sizes and shapes, so you can find the one that meets your specific requirements.

The style of your electric fireplace could be enhanced with the addition of corbels. These decorative elements can give the room a a traditional look that complements the rest of your decor. The brackets can match the color scheme in your space by painting or staining them. You can also pick natural finishes that let the beauty of the wood shine through. The selection of wood is crucial, as each species has its own distinct texture and grain pattern that will affect how the corbels look when they are finished.

If you're looking to add a special touch to your kitchen or make your mantel appear more elegant Corbels made of wood can be a great option. These architectural structures consist of 90-degree brackets that can be used to help support or decorate the interior of a room. Outside, they are used to beautify porches and eaves. They can draw the eye upward to help a small room appear larger. They can be carved inside to look like decorative columns. They are commonly used to support island bars, mantels and countertops.
